A man who specializes in scamming people on Facebook by disguising as a woman has been convicted by a court in Kano state.

Abubakar Isiaku A.K.A Hajia Fatima sentenced by a court
 
Justice Muhammad Yahaya of Kano State High Court, on Monday, February 19, 2018 convicted and sentenced one Abubakar Isiaku A.K.A Hajia Fatima to one year imprisonment. 
 
Isiaku was sentenced on a one count charge for the offence of Obtaining by False Pretence brought against him by the Kaduna Zonal Office of the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, EFCC.
 
The convict's sojourn to prison began sometimes ago after he decided to disguise as a woman and extort money from unsuspecting members of the public via Facebook. 
 
He made the complainant believe he is woman which made them become very close friends. Ishaku started extorting money from his victim to the tune of about N1.5 million (One Million Five Hundred Thousand Naira) only. 
 
In the course of prosecution, the convict changed his plea to guilty from not guilty after he was arriagned on 18th December, 2017.  The Jugde also ordered the convict, Abubakar to pay the sum of One Million Five Hundred Thousand Naira to the nominal complainant as restitution.
